iOS 26: 3D Spatial Photos — A Game-Changing Visual Upgrade

Apple is introducing a standout new feature in iOS 26: the ability to view any photo in 3D with spatial depth, even if the original image wasn’t captured using spatial effects. Borrowed from the Apple Vision Pro experience, this feature cleverly separates the foreground and background in your photos using advanced computer vision and Apple’s Neural Engine.

The effect works intuitively. On the Lock screen, your wallpaper becomes a living image that subtly shifts as you move your iPhone, while the time display dynamically adjusts to the 3D layout. In the Photos app, tilting your phone activates the spatial depth effect, giving images a sense of movement and realism that responds to how you’re holding the device.

Apple’s Craig Federighi highlighted this innovation during WWDC, explaining how machine learning and the neural processor are used to reinterpret 2D photos into vibrant, layered scenes. This gives users a delightful, immersive way to revisit their memories, without needing to take action other than updating to iOS 26.

Importantly, the new feature doesn’t require images to be captured in a special format—it applies universally to existing photos in your library. This ease of use, combined with the cinematic visual appeal, makes spatial photos one of the most anticipated features of iOS 26.

AI-Driven Photo Transformation

The backbone of this new feature lies in Apple’s Neural Engine, a specialized AI processor capable of performing trillions of operations per second. Using real-time depth analysis and layering algorithms, the iPhone interprets flat images by estimating spatial relationships within the scene—essentially turning flat images into 3D illusions.

This isn’t just a visual gimmick—it’s an application of artificial intelligence that uses years of data to understand depth cues in imagery. From subtle shadow recognition to facial landmark detection, the engine identifies which parts of a photo should be “closer” or “farther,” layering them accordingly.

Lock Screen Interactivity Reimagined

The Lock screen now functions more like a live canvas. Apple doesn’t just animate photos—it integrates UI elements, like the clock and widgets, into the spatial field. That means the time display can appear to float between the photo’s foreground and background, enhancing immersion and giving your phone a dynamic look that changes with motion.
